How are your fluids?

Automotive fluids play a crucial role in the proper functioning and maintenance of your vehicle. There are several different types of fluids, each with its unique purpose, and they must be checked regularly to ensure the optimal performance of your vehicle.

What are the essential automotive fluids, what do they do, and how do I check them:

Prior to checking any fluids in your vehicle, make sure your vehicle has cooled down and you are in a safe area out of the way of traffic.

Engine oil:

The engine oil is responsible for lubricating the moving parts in your engine and preventing them from grinding together, causing heat, and eventual damage. To check your engine oil, locate the dipstick, remove it, and wipe it clean. Then reinsert it and remove it again to read the oil level. If it’s low, top it up with the correct oil

Transmission fluid:

The transmission fluid acts as a lubricant to the transmission gears and ensures they are functioning correctly. To check the fluid, find the dipstick, remove it, and wipe it clean. Reinsert the dipstick and check the reading. The fluid should be a clear red color. If it's a brownish or burnt smell, it's time for a replacement.

Brake fluid:

The brake fluid ensures the brakes work smoothly and prevents rusting and corrosion within the braking system. To check your brake fluid level, locate the brake fluid reservoir, and ensure it’s at the proper level indicated on the reservoir. If it's low, add the proper brake fluid and inspect for leaks.

Coolant:

The coolant helps regulate your engine temperature by absorbing the heat generated from the combustion of fuel. Check your coolant levels when the engine is cool, locate the reservoir tank and verify that the fluid is between the minimum and maximum levels.

In case you notice any warning signs such as decreased fuel efficiency, overheating, weird sounds, or unpleasant smells coming from your vehicle, this may indicate a problem with one of the fluids mentioned above.
